private void StartAnimation(bool isActionImmediate) { // Camera can be animated with using StartRotation method. // StartRotation take two parameters - headingChangeInSecond and attitudeChangeInSecond // Advantage of using StartRotation method over using Storyboard animation of Heading or Attitude properties is that // StartRotation does not lock the Heading and Attitude properties. // The StartRotation also works very good with CameraControlPanel and MouseCameraController - while the camera is rotating it is possible // to manually change camera with the mouse or with the buttons on CameraControlPanel double headingChangeInSecond = HeadingChangeInSecondSlider.Value; double attitudeChangeInSecond = AttitudeChangeInSecondSlider.Value; if (isActionImmediate) { Camera1.StartRotation(headingChangeInSecond, attitudeChangeInSecond); // No easing } else { double accelerationSpeed = AccelerationSpeedSlider.Value; SphericalCamera.EasingFunctionDelegate easingFunction = GetEaseInFunction(); // NOTE that ease in and ease out are different functions Camera1.StartRotation(headingChangeInSecond, attitudeChangeInSecond, accelerationSpeed, easingFunction); } StartStopSlowlyButton.Content = "STOP rotation slowly"; StartStopNowButton.Content = "STOP rotation now"; AccelerationSpeedTextBlock.Text = "decelerationSpeed (0 = disabled):"; _isRotationStarted = true; }

public LinesSelector() { InitializeComponent(); // LineSelectorData is a utility class that can be used to get the closest distance // of a specified screen position to the 3D line. _lineSelectorData = new List <LineSelectorData>(); for (int i = 0; i < 15; i++) { // Create random 3D lines var randomColor = GetRandomColor(); var lineVisual3D = GenerateRandomLine(randomColor, 10); // Create LineSelectorData from each line. // When adjustLineDistanceWithLineThickness is true, then distance is measured from line edge. // If adjustLineDistanceWithLineThickness is false, then distance is measured from center of the line. var lineSelectorData = new LineSelectorData(lineVisual3D, Camera1, adjustLineDistanceWithLineThickness: true); // LineSelectorData transform the line positions when there is any transformation set to the lineVisual3D's Transform property // (in this case the lineSelectorData.PositionsTransform3D is set to the used transformation). // // But when the lineVisual3D is added to a parent Visual3D that has its own transformation, // then LineSelectorData is not "aware" of that transformation. // To demonstrate that, the lineVisual3D in this sample is added to a RootVisual3D that has TranslateTransform3D with OffsetX = 20. // // Because we know the organization of objects in this sample, we could simple write the following to support that: // lineSelectorData.PositionsTransform3D = RootVisual3D.Transform; // // But there is a more general way that can be used. // With help of TransformationsHelper.GetVisual3DTotalTransform it is possible // to get the combined (total) transformation from Viewport3D to the lineVisual3D. // This also includes the transformation on lineVisual3D (second parameter in GetVisual3DTotalTransform is true). // // This methods can be also used to check if specified Visual3D is connected to Viewport3D (it sets an out parameter isVisualConnected). // There is also another override of this method that takes two Visual3D objects and gets the transformation from the first to the second. bool isVisualConnected; // This will be set to true if lineVisual3D is connected to Viewport3D (always true in our case). lineSelectorData.PositionsTransform3D = Ab3d.Utilities.TransformationsHelper.GetVisual3DTotalTransform(lineVisual3D, true, out isVisualConnected); _lineSelectorData.Add(lineSelectorData); } _isCameraChanged = true; // When true, the CalculateScreenSpacePositions method is called before calculating line distances Camera1.CameraChanged += delegate(object sender, CameraChangedRoutedEventArgs e) { _isCameraChanged = true; UpdateClosestLine(); }; this.MouseMove += delegate(object sender, MouseEventArgs e) { _lastMousePosition = e.GetPosition(MainBorder); UpdateClosestLine(); }; Camera1.StartRotation(20, 0); }
